Welcome to Advancing the Field of Cancer Patient Navigation: A Toolkit for Comprehensive Cancer Control Professionals. We developed this toolkit to guide states in advancing patient navigation. Although there are several types of navigators for which the information presented may be relevant, the focus of the toolkit is largely on patient navigators. Throughout this toolkit, we use the term "patient navigators" to specifically refer to navigators who are neither nurses nor social workers who work within the health care system and we use the term "navigators" broadly to encompass patient navigators, social workers and nurse navigators.
